2

私は現在、小さなヘッドレスを持っています(そして、私は確かにそれをそのままにしておきたいです:))テストのために、出力がXmingに来るX11アプリケーション(Firefox)を実行したいVagrantとVirtualBoxでセットアップされたLinux仮想マシンを持っています私の実機。それはすべてハンキードーリーで、完璧に機能していますが、まだ満足していません!

私ができるようにしたいのは、いくつかのセットアップを行い、すべてが正しく実行されていることを確認してから、サーバーから切断してテストを実行することです。ただし、何か問題が発生した場合、または現在の状態を確認したい場合 (一部のテストは数時間かかる場合があります) は、サーバーに戻って X11 出力を自分のマシンに再び向けたいと思います。しかし、私が数時間前に知らなかった X11 についての Google と学習負荷にもかかわらず、X11 アプリケーションの出力がどこに行くかを選択することについて何も見つけることができません。

DISPLAY=:10 firefox &

Xephyr XServerがこれを行ったというランダムなブログ投稿を読みました(中間X11バッファーとして機能し、必要に応じてリダイレクトし、そうでない場合は/ dev/nullに出力するだけです)が、他の参照が見つかりませんそれに、またはそれを行う他の何か。

4

2 に答える 2

2

「スクリーン」のように動作する X-session 用の Xpra というプログラムがあります。リモートアクセスのために、メインのセッションとは別の X セッションを開始しますが、ホストマシンから自由に接続/切断できます。

http://www.xpra.org/

于 2016-03-25T16:11:33.440 に答える
0

私は現在、これを行うための1つの受け入れ可能な方法を持っています。これは私の目的を果たします.firefoxの出力を取得するvnc4serverを実行しています。通常のV​​NCサーバーと同じように、問題なく接続および切断できます。これにより、やりたいことはできますが、やりたい方法ではできません。VNC サーバーをまったく必要とせずにこれを実行できるようにしたいと考えています。

于 2012-09-06T22:33:07.807 に答える